Coming from the Paris region
First step: join Montereau
From Lyon station, choose :
- the transilian R
- the TER Burgundy direction Laroche-Migennes
In particular:
- Train frequency : every hour
- Duration: 1 hour from Lyon station
- Cost : Montereau being in Seine-et-Marne in the Île-de-France region, the Navigo pass works. Otherwise, the ticket costs €2.5.
- These trains also pass through Melun and Fontainebleau.
It is also possible to take the RER D until Melun, then the transilian R to Montereau.
2nd stage: reach the Campus from Montereau station (bike, bus, TAD, carpooling)
Cycling
- This is the fastest way to reach the place: count 25 minutes to a normal pace to travel 7 km and 70 m of elevation positive.
- On trains from Paris, spaces are dedicated to bicycles in certain cars.

By bus
- Le bus 3307 (external link) drop you directly at the Campus (jump of Forges).
- Buses 3301 (external link)(Freedom) and 3304 (external link) or 3308 (external link) (Gardeloup stop) can also be an option. They pass more frequently, but there is a 30-minute walk to the Campus.
